■Eco Drive Display
The vehicle icon on the display moves forward or backward while driving.
The more aggressive the acceleration is, the further the icon moves forward.
The more aggressive the deceleration is, the further the icon moves backward.
Keep the icon near the center of the circ le for better fuel economy while driving.

■Drive Cycle Score/Lifetime Points
Appear for a few seconds when you set th e power mode to VEHICLE OFF. Each has
three stages. Depending on your driving style, the leaf icon(s) and the gauge
increase or decrease to indicate that yo u have reached a different stage of fuel
economy.
■Resetting the Drive Cycle Score
1. Make sure the shift position is in
(P. Turn the power mode to ON.
2. If ECON mode is on, press the ECON button to turn it off.
3. Turn the power mode to VEHICLE OFF.
4. Turn the power mode to ON again.
u Make sure to complete steps fro m 4 through 6 within 30 seconds.
5. Depress the brake pedal twice.
6. Press the ECON button twice.
u The color of the ambient mete r will turn to monochrome.
7. Turn the power mode to VEHICLE OFF.

Locking/Unlocking the Doors from the Outside
When you carry the sm art entry remote, you
can lock/unlock the doors and open the
tailgate.
You can lock/unlock the doors within a radius
of about 32 inches (80 cm) of the outside door
handle or tailgate outer handle.
■Locking the doors and tailgate
Touch the door lock sensor on the front door
or press the lock button on the tailgate. u Some exterior lights flash; the beeper
sounds; all the doors and tailgate lock;
and the security system
* sets.
■Using the Smart Entry with Push Button Start System1Locking/Unlocking the Doors from the Outside
If the interior light switch is in the door activated
position, the interior light comes on when you unlock
the doors and tailgate.
No doors opened: The li ght fades out after 30
seconds.
Doors and tailgate relo cked: The light goes off
immediately.
2 Interior Lights P. 217
1Using the Smart Entry with Push Button Start System
If you do not open a door or the tailgate within 30
seconds of unlocking the vehicle with the smart entry
system, the doors and tailg ate will automatically
relock.
You can lock or unlock doors using the smart entry
system only when the power mode is in VEHICLE OFF.
•Do not leave the smart entry remote in the vehicle
when you get out. Carry it with you.
•Even if you are not carrying the smart entry remote,
you can lock/unlock the doors and tailgate while
someone else with the remote is within range.
•The door may be locked or unlocked if the door
handle is covered with wate r in heavy rain or in a
car wash if the smart entry remote is within range.
•If you grip a front door ha ndle or touch a door lock
sensor wearing gloves, the door sensor may be
slow to respond or may no t respond by locking or
unlocking the doors.

■Unlocking the doors and tailgate
Grab the driver’s door handle: u The driver’s door unlocks.
u Some exterior lights flash twice and the
beeper sounds twice.
Grab the front passenger’s door handle:
u All the doors and tailgate unlock.
u Some exterior lights flash twice and the
beeper sounds twice.
Press the tailgate outer handle: u The tailgate unlocks.
u Some exterior lights flash twice and the
beeper sounds twice.
2 Opening/Closing the Tailgate P. 167
1Using the Smart Entry with Push Button Start System
•After locking the door, you have up to 2 seconds
during which you can pull the door handle to
confirm whether the door is locked. If you need to
unlock the door immediately after locking it, wait
at least 2 seconds befo re gripping the handle,
otherwise the door will not unlock.
•The door might not open if you pull it immediately
after gripping the door handle. Grip the handle
again and confirm that th e door is unlocked before
pulling the handle.
•Even within the 32 inches (80 cm) radius, you may
not be able to lock/unlock the doors and the
tailgate with the smart entry remote if it is above or
below the outside handle.
•The smart entry remote may not operate if it is too
close to the door and door glass.

■Locking the doors and tailgate (Walk
away auto lock ®)
When you walk away fro m the vehicle with all
doors and tailgate closed while carrying the
smart entry remote, th e doors and tailgate will
automatically lock.
The auto lock function activates when all
doors and tailgate are closed, and the smart
entry remote is within about 5 feet (1.5 m)
radius of the outside door handle.
Exit vehicle while carry ing smart entry remote
and close door(s) and tailgate.
1. While within about 5 feet (1.5 m) radius of
the vehicle.
u The beeper sounds; the auto lock
function will be activated.
2. Carry the smart entry remote beyond about
5 feet (1.5 m) from the vehicle and remain
outside this range for 2 or more seconds.
u Some exterior lights flash; the beeper
sounds; all doors and tailgate will then
lock.1Locking the doors and tailg ate (Walk away auto lock®)
The auto lock function is set to OFF as the factory
default setting. The auto lo ck function can be set to
ON using the driver information interface
* or audio/
information screen*.
If you set the auto lock function to ON using the
driver information interface
* or audio/information
screen*, only the smart entry remote that was used to
unlock the driver’s door prio r to the setting change
can activate auto lock.
2 Customized Features P. 140
2 Customized Features P. 368
After the auto lock function has been activated, when
you stay within the locking/unlocking operation range,
the indicator on the smart en try remote will continue to
flash until the doors and tailgate are locked.
When you stay beside the vehicle within the
operation range, the door s and tailgate will
automatically lock approx imately 30 seconds after
the auto lock function activating beeper sounds.
When you open a door or tailgate after the auto lock
function activating beeper sounds, the auto lock
function will be canceled.

To temporarily deactivate the function:
1. Set the power mode to OFF.
2. Open the driver’s door.
3. Using the master door lock switch, operate
the lock as follows:
Lock Unlock Lock Unlock.
u The beeper sounds and the function is
deactivated.
To restore the function:
• Set the power mode to ON.
• Lock the vehicle without using the auto lock
function.
• With the smart entry re mote on you, move
out of the auto lock function operation
range.
• Open any door.1Locking the doors and tailg ate (Walk away auto lock®)
Under the following circumstances, the auto lock
function will not activate:
•The remote is inside the vehicle.
u The beeper will not sound.
•The remote is taken out of its operational range
before all doors and ta ilgate are closed.
u The beeper will sound.
If equipped, the user mu st wait until the power
tailgate fully closes before the auto lock function will
be activated.
The auto lock function does not operate when any of
the following conditions are met.
•The smart entry remote is inside the vehicle.•A door, tailgate or th e hood is not closed.•The power mode is set to any mode other than OFF.•The smart entry remote is not located within a
radius of about 5 feet (1 .5 m) from the vehicle
when you get out of the vehicle and close the
doors and tailgate.
Auto lock function operation stop beeper
After the auto lock function has been activated, the
auto lock operation stop beeper sounds for
approximately two seconds in the following cases.
•The smart entry remote is put inside the vehicle
through a window.
•You are located too close to the vehicle.•The smart entry remote is put inside the tailgate.
If the warning beeper sounds, check that you are
carrying the smart entry remote. Then, open/close a
door and confirm the auto lock activation beeper
sounds once.
